The HR Contact Center Specialist serves as the first point of contact for employees and managers in the US for HR-related questions and transactions. This role provides support across HR policies, employee data changes, case management, and basic Workday processing to ensure accurate, timely, and professional service.
Your responsibilities
- Respond to employee and manager inquiries via phone, email, chat, or case management system.
- Provide guidance on US HR policies, procedures, and employee lifecycle processes.
- Process and validate HR transactions in Workday, including hires, job changes, terminations, updates, and personal data changes.
- Research and resolve issues independently when possible, or route/escalate complex cases to the appropriate HR team.
- Maintain accurate case notes, documentation, and transaction records.
- Support employee self-service and educate users on how to complete common tasks in Workday.
- Ensure compliance with HR data privacy, internal controls, and service level targets.
- Partner with HR, payroll, benefits, and other stakeholders to resolve employee issues.
- Identify process gaps and contribute to continuous improvement efforts.

ABB Ltd (German: ABB AG, French, Italian, Romansh: ABB SA),formerly ASEA Brown Boveri, is a Swedish-Swiss multinational corporation headquartered in Västerås, Sweden, and Zürich, Switzerland.operating mainly in robotics, power, heavy electrical equipment, and automation technology areas. It is ranked 341st in the Fortune Global 500 list of 2018 and has been a global Fortune 500 company for 24 years.Until the sale of its Power Grids division in 2020, ABB was Switzerland's largest industrial employer.ABB is traded on the SIX Swiss Exchange in Zürich, Nasdaq Stockholm and the New York Stock Exchange in the United States.
